Proposition 1: Use the MUX when filling the ufluidic device so that there is a barrier through which air shall not pass when we change fluids.

Proposition 2: Not use MUX ;) cells can't enter the machine. Fill a falcon tube with fluid (cells) and insert it into the inlet (make sure it is filled with the fluid - no air!). Using a syringe connecte to the outlet, we want to create a backflow, sucking the fluid into the chip.

Today

Microfluidics: Not one bubble got inside the chip. We are very happy :D. Used proposition 1 - filled a tube with PBS and used MUX to stop the flow when we saw the fluid coming out. Then inserted the tube in the chip and started the flow. Did this again with methyl blue, it worked but didn't see any color. Couldn't try proposition 2 because the outlet didn't allow fluid into the tube (it went directly out of the chip). Can do this next time!
